      Extended Stay on the ISS: The Boeing Starliner Failure

      The unexpected extension of the astronauts' stay on the International Space Station (ISS) was primarily due to the failure of Boeing's Starliner test flight. Initially planned as a short mission, the astronauts were required to spend nine months aboard the ISS when the Crew Test Flight of Boeing's spacecraft encountered critical issues, as highlighted in a report on the matter . This unanticipated extension was taxing on both the crew and ground control teams who had to adapt to the prolonged mission conditions.
        The Boeing Starliner, tasked with transporting astronauts, faced significant setbacks due to technical failures. The spacecraft underwent a Crew Test Flight that did not meet NASA's stringent requirements, primarily because of thruster issues . These problems have prevented its certification for regular crewed missions and have called into question Boeing's ability to provide reliable transportation to and from the ISS. Such challenges have sparked debates about the future viability of the Starliner program and Boeing's role in crewed spaceflight missions.
          Boeing's setbacks with the Starliner have consequently raised significant financial and operational concerns. The failure led to discussions within NASA about potentially conducting a third uncrewed test flight to verify the spacecraft's systems before any future crewed missions can be greenlighted . The financial pressures on Boeing, exacerbated by these issues, also raise doubts about the program's continuation and the company's long‑term commitments to space exploration. Analysts suggest that the challenges faced by Boeing may necessitate a reevaluation of their business strategy, possibly even considering selling their space division.

                        Elon Musk and Donald Trump's Controversial Claims

                        The recent splashdown of the SpaceX Crew‑9 in the ocean, accompanied by a playful pod of dolphins, has captured the attention of the world, highlighting both the triumphs and tribulations associated with modern space exploration. The mission was marked by controversy surrounding false claims by two prominent figures—Elon Musk and Donald Trump. According to reports, Musk and Trump alleged that President Biden had refused a purported offer from Musk to deploy his company for a rescue mission to retrieve the astronauts stranded on the International Space Station (ISS) due to technical difficulties with Boeing's Starliner [Jalopnik]. These assertions, however, were firmly rebutted by NASA officials and the astronauts themselves, emphasizing a commitment to the planned mission timeline.
                          Elon Musk has established a reputation for bold claims and visionary endeavors, often igniting public discourse around space travel and technology. His assertion about the rejected rescue mission, however, has seen scrutiny and raised questions about reliability and accuracy in communication between public figures and governmental space agencies. Miscommunications in such high‑stakes environments can lead to political and public relations challenges. Danish astronaut Andreas Mogensen's accusation of Musk lying, points to the misinformation potentially damaging collaborative efforts and trust between entities involved in space exploration [The Guardian].
